# Fight begins in a laundry room, ends with assault with dog repellent

On October 2, at approximately 11:10 p.m., an officer was dispatched to the 600 block of Pico Boulevard in regards to a battery. Upon arriving, the officer was met by the victim and she stated that for the past year she and the subject, later identified as Marcie Monroe, 50, of Santa Monica, have had an ongoing dispute. Monroe and the victim both live in the same apartment complex, and on this particular day Monroe was inside the laundry room when the victim attempted to enter the room. The door was locked and when the victim asked Monroe to unlock the door, she refused. After multiple requests were made, an argument ensued. After the argument, Monroe walked up to her apartment and stood in the doorway as the victim walked toward her screaming and yelling. In what Monroe described as self-defense, she sprayed dog repellent in the victim's eyes. When the officer contacted the victim, he noticed that the left side of her face was red and swollen and she complained of pain to her eyes and face. Monroe was arrested for assault with a dangerous weapon. Bail was set at $50,000.
